One key to determining whether a trucking business is profitable is to understand what’s an acceptable U.S. industry profit margin. While carrier revenue and profits vary depending on their unique situations, most truckers should aim for a 6%-8% profit. Plan your profit by considering your gross annual income … See more Though numerous factors determine how profitable a trucking business is, the two main factors to keep in mind are fixed and variable costs. WebThis research enables you to determine if your trucking business will be profitable. 6. Keep the money flowing. As your business grows, you are likely to encounter shippers who are slow payers. While owner-operators like quick pays, most shippers (and brokers) like to pay their invoices in 30 to 60 days. This delay can create cash flow problems ...
